Running payroll is a simple 9-step process in PaymentEvolution.  Each step of the process allows you to validate and confirm the data you've entered. If you need to stop part way through a pay run - no problem - we save all your work and allow you to come back later to finish the process
First, make sure you've set your Company Settings and  added your employees
To run your payroll, follow these 9 simple steps;

  1. Click on RUN PAYROLL in the menu bar.
     

    Pro-Tip: you may be asked if this is a new remittance period.  If your pay date for the pay run you are about to perform falls in your next period, or you prefer to have reports for EACH pay run, you should click YES. 
    The payroll steps menu bar will appear with each section opening when it is available

     
  2. SELECT PAY CYCLE 

    Enter the employee Payment date
    Choose the Payroll Type- depending on your plan you may see
           - Regular- this is your regular pay run period
           - Special- this is for adding additional items for an employee already processed in a regular run
           - Manual- this is available on select plans to allow for a negative data entry pay run
Choose the Pay Cycle (Frequency) for this pay run
Enter From and To dates for the work dates for this pay run
Click Submit

  2. SALARIES

    Your list of salaried employees will be displayed next. We will pre-fill the number of hours, their pay rate and total amount of earnings for you. You can make any adjustments if necessary.   Approve the regular hours by checking the box to the left of the employee name and click APPROVE at the top.
  
You can also Add+ other earnings by clicking the appropriate icon next to the employee name 
  
  1. TIMESHEETS

    Employees who are time-based (i.e. paid by the hour) will be displayed on this screen. If you are in Bulk Mode (found under SETTINGS>PAYROLL OPTIONS) enter the hours for the entire time period.  If you are in Daily Mode we will pre-fill hours for you based on the employees’ average hours per week on their employee profile.  To clear all hours, click the "clear" icon. 
  
If you haven’t set up your timesheet preference in Payroll Options you can switch from Daily to Bulk by clicking the BULK/DAILY icon

If you are integrated with any of our partners for timesheets (Freshbooks or T-Sheets) you can import your hours by clicking the IMPORT icon

After entering hours select the employees you would like to approve for pay by checking  the box to the left of the employee name and click APPROVE at the top.

You can also Add+ other earnings by clicking the appropriate icon next to the employee name 
  1. CALCULATE

    Once you completed entering wages, hours and other earnings - click calculate. You will be prompted to choose to calculate using the system defaults or a custom calculation. For most pay runs, the system default is appropriate. If you would like to turn any specific rules on or off for just this pay run use the custom option.
Pro-Tip: If you have benefits or deductions applied to your employees and are running a special run, typically you would use custom calculations to turn these off.  The employee’s pay would already have them add/subtracted in their regular pay run
  1. REVIEW 

    Once the calculations are complete, you'll be able to view the results by employee. Using the dropdown box, you'll be able to view a pay slip for an employee. You can make manual changes to the employee's pay in certain circumstances.  This is not typically recommended but is available.  Click Save if you make any manual changes. 
  
Use the VIEW JOURNAL button to download a PDF of all employees in this pay run

Pro-Tip: we STRONGLY recommend that you review all employee amounts before completing your pay run.  You can go back to any step, pay rule or employee to make changes.  If you make changes outside the pay run you must calculate again to get the new information pulled in.
*Note: changes to an employee pay rate will NOT change an approved line in salaries/timesheets.  Instead update the line rate in the pay run (after you update the employee) and click SAVE
  1. PAYMENTS

    Here you can process the payments for your employees. If you are processing electronic payments the system will process them for you. If you are paying via cheque, the system will generate a cheque report which you can use to print cheques on pre-printed cheque stock.
    Choose your Funding Source, confirm payment dates and switch employee payment type (direct deposit/cheque) as needed 

    Review your final amounts and enter your PIN (available on paid plans)  or enable it if you choose

  2. Click Finish this pay run

When you are using ePay the Authorization screen is the MOST IMPORTANT screen of your pay run.  It tells you the employee payment date, how the pay run is funded, the amount that will be debited/expected, the debit date/expected date and bank information.  If any of these are not accurate click Go back.  If everything looks good click Yes, Authorize

Up until this point, you can go back to any point in the payroll process and make adjustments as needed. After you click Yes, Authorize, the pay run is committed and is not editable.
